Full-Time Intake Counselor (Former Student / ADC-T / LADC)Fellowship Recovery | St. Louis Park, MNFellowship Recovery is an outpatient treatment program based in the Twin Cities, offering co-occurring (substance use disorder and mental health) services in a supportive, growth-oriented environment. We believe in smaller group sizes, strong clinical support, and creating a workplace that promotes sustainability, growth, and prevention of burnout. We are a growing organization with an entrepreneurial spirit and a strong commitment to high-quality client care.Our Intake and Admissions team plays a critical role in welcoming new clients into our programs, ensuring safe, timely, and compliant entry into services across our locations.This RoleThe Full-Time Intake Counselor is a core member of the Intake and Admissions team, responsible for managing client intakes, coordinating admissions, and supporting the overall intake workflow across programs. This role plays a key part in ensuring consistency, efficiency, and compliance in the admissions process while maintaining a high level of client care and communication.This is a full-time position with consistent scheduling and a central role in supporting program access and flow.Job Type & ScheduleStatus: Full-Time, ExemptSchedule: Monday–FridayLocation: St. Louis ParkCompensation & BenefitsSalary Structure (based on licensure status):Former Student (no ADC-T or LADC yet but in the works): $58,000 annuallyADC-T Licensed: $60,000 annuallyLADC Licensed: $62,000 – $65,000 annually (based on experience and licensure)Compensation adjustments will be made upon verification of licensure.Full-Time Benefits Include:Medical, dental, and vision insurancePaid Time Off (PTO) based on tenurePaid holidaysEarned Safe and Sick Time (ESST) in accordance with MN lawEligibility to participate in the company 401(k) planOption to enroll in voluntary supplemental insurance through AFLACPrimary DutiesComplete client intake assessments and admissions documentationCoordinate intake scheduling and communicate admission status to clinical teamsEnsure clients are safely and appropriately transitioned into servicesMaintain accurate, timely, and compliant intake documentationCommunicate with referral sources, families, and internal staff as neededManage intake workflow and support coverage needs across programsEnsure compliance with MN Statutes 245G and applicable licensure requirementsFollow all Fellowship Recovery policies, training plans, and compliance proceduresExperience & RequirementsADC-T required within 90 days of starting in the role, if not currently licensedBackground or experience in substance use disorder or mental health services preferredStrong communication, organization, and documentation skillsAbility to manage multiple tasks while maintaining attention to detailProfessional judgment, reliability, and a client-centered approachAbility to work independently while collaborating with a multidisciplinary teamPlease note this job description is not a comprehensive list of job duties, activities, tasks and responsibilities.
